PHPackages                             faktiva/php-redis-admin - PHPackages - PHPackages  [Skip to content](#main-content)[PHPackages](/)[Directory](/)[Categories](/categories)[Trending](/trending)[Leaderboard](/leaderboard)[Changelog](/changelog)[Analyze](/analyze)[Collections](/collections)[Log in](/login)[Sign up](/register)

1. [Directory](/)
2. /
3. [Caching](/categories/caching)
4. /
5. faktiva/php-redis-admin

AbandonedArchivedProject[Caching](/categories/caching)

faktiva/php-redis-admin
=======================

PHP Redis Admin is a simple web interface to manage and monitor your Redis server(s).

1.2.3(9y ago)242.3k111MITJavaScriptPHP &gt;=5.4.0

Since Oct 20Pushed 8y ago3 watchersCompare

[ Source](https://github.com/faktiva/php-redis-admin)[ Packagist](https://packagist.org/packages/faktiva/php-redis-admin)[ Docs](https://github.com/faktiva/php-redis-admin)[ RSS](/packages/faktiva-php-redis-admin/feed)WikiDiscussions master Synced 1mo ago

READMEChangelog (4)Dependencies (4)Versions (5)Used By (1)

[![SensioLabsInsight](https://camo.githubusercontent.com/ca52a342913eb8b891b52342e27c03df437dbcfc0fdbbdd0ffe3ca334d9667b0/68747470733a2f2f696e73696768742e73656e73696f6c6162732e636f6d2f70726f6a656374732f38663035383763392d316564372d343466652d386133362d3162636536623530363332622f736d616c6c2e706e67)](https://insight.sensiolabs.com/projects/8f0587c9-1ed7-44fe-8a36-1bce6b50632b)[PHP Redis Admin](https://github.com/faktiva/php-redis-admin)
===================================================================================================================================================================================================================================================================================================================================================================================================================================================

[](#php-redis-admin)

[![GitHub release](https://camo.githubusercontent.com/9cbef8140ca5a6ebd96ee9590b5c4e78e11708e7bab4407d1166f498f8b5d192/68747470733a2f2f696d672e736869656c64732e696f2f6769746875622f72656c656173652f66616b746976612f7068702d72656469732d61646d696e2e7376673f7374796c653d666c6174266c6162656c3d6c6174657374)](https://github.com/faktiva/php-redis-admin/releases/latest)[![Project Status](https://camo.githubusercontent.com/0addaa5693fbd31084f39bb565cb3f26c9ec78dbe16aeee182e3560d0258722f/687474703a2f2f6f70656e736f757263652e626f782e636f6d2f6261646765732f6163746976652e7376673f7374796c653d666c6174)](http://opensource.box.com/badges)[![Percentage of issues still open](https://camo.githubusercontent.com/5bf85ccd0cd53ce5ddfc73df1cbb7a61a4afbba29ee32f8114834bcd20f9b047/687474703a2f2f697369746d61696e7461696e65642e636f6d2f62616467652f6f70656e2f66616b746976612f7068702d72656469732d61646d696e2e7376673f7374796c653d666c6174)](http://isitmaintained.com/project/faktiva/php-redis-admin "Percentage of issues still open")[![Average time to resolve an issue](https://camo.githubusercontent.com/a668b80ecc5b52790322898db9080d541ee26573703df7fe7522afc91e87af2b/687474703a2f2f697369746d61696e7461696e65642e636f6d2f62616467652f7265736f6c7574696f6e2f66616b746976612f7068702d72656469732d61646d696e2e7376673f7374796c653d666c6174)](http://isitmaintained.com/project/faktiva/php-redis-admin "Average time to resolve an issue")[![composer.lock](https://camo.githubusercontent.com/c1ca713f0da45535dbab0da5e7ff2bd74981b7f3fa3617e3a538daddbcb5f844/68747470733a2f2f706f7365722e707567782e6f72672f66616b746976612f7068702d72656469732d61646d696e2f636f6d706f7365726c6f636b3f7374796c653d666c6174)](https://packagist.org/packages/faktiva/php-redis-admin)[![Dependencies Status](https://camo.githubusercontent.com/c36e0177ccc2b3be11ce7a3d8eb1f10b4844cee105c04c10e7afa6448f717d61/68747470733a2f2f696d672e736869656c64732e696f2f6c6962726172696573696f2f6769746875622f66616b746976612f7068702d72656469732d61646d696e2e7376673f6d61784167653d33363030267374796c653d666c6174)](https://libraries.io/github/faktiva/php-redis-admin)[![License](https://camo.githubusercontent.com/c83cae468286c5c0c3a62f2b820d387daeca0a6331471d291365d8002904e538/68747470733a2f2f696d672e736869656c64732e696f2f7061636b61676973742f6c2f66616b746976612f7068702d72656469732d61646d696e2e7376673f7374796c653d666c6174)](https://tldrlegal.com/license/mit-license)

[![Docker Pulls](https://camo.githubusercontent.com/f3cbf6abac7ffb4f5b6489f75c8bd4f5dacaa6292b2dd10d21e4074a8d63b379/68747470733a2f2f696d672e736869656c64732e696f2f646f636b65722f70756c6c732f66616b746976612f7068702d72656469732d61646d696e2e737667)](https://hub.docker.com/r/faktiva/php-redis-admin)[![Docker Stars](https://camo.githubusercontent.com/8397abb5616473b27139a0e057f0b4e0cc92111e4253e1ba636c0787f136f5ba/68747470733a2f2f696d672e736869656c64732e696f2f646f636b65722f73746172732f66616b746976612f7068702d72656469732d61646d696e2e737667)](https://hub.docker.com/r/faktiva/php-redis-admin)[![Docker Layers](https://camo.githubusercontent.com/0f1b885dc42a37fbbb79e0cd7cfb68189bdaf01fc185f415d994c03dc64e4414/68747470733a2f2f696d616765732e6d6963726f6261646765722e636f6d2f6261646765732f696d6167652f66616b746976612f7068702d72656469732d61646d696e2e737667)](https://microbadger.com/images/faktiva/php-redis-admin)[![Docker Version](https://camo.githubusercontent.com/2c26dd351535d3d3587fec3397f08ee8a74fe187a09c4e4a1d2603a438e03df6/68747470733a2f2f696d616765732e6d6963726f6261646765722e636f6d2f6261646765732f76657273696f6e2f66616b746976612f7068702d72656469732d61646d696e2e737667)](https://microbadger.com/images/faktiva/php-redis-admin)

[![Join the chat at https://gitter.im/faktiva/php-redis-admin](https://camo.githubusercontent.com/deabc578fdb55ad20b7825de97387109f3206c4a624f366018b0f995b4133f56/68747470733a2f2f696d672e736869656c64732e696f2f62616467652f4769747465722d434841542532304e4f572d627269676874677265656e2e7376673f7374796c653d666c6174)](https://gitter.im/faktiva/php-redis-admin)[![Twitter](https://camo.githubusercontent.com/2ff941104570215394390823e5665129748bb4d0eb7f67ef8cac69028fcbb219/68747470733a2f2f696d672e736869656c64732e696f2f747769747465722f75726c2f68747470732f6769746875622e636f6d2f66616b746976612f7068702d72656469732d61646d696e2e7376673f7374796c653d736f6369616c)](https://twitter.com/intent/tweet?text=Look+at+this:+%23Faktiva+%22PHP+Redis+Admin%22&url=https://github.com/faktiva/php-redis-admin)

---

**A web interface to manage and monitor your Redis server(s).**

> For production use the **latest stable [release](https://github.com/faktiva/php-redis-admin/releases/latest)**
>
> This is a maintained fork of [PHPRedMin](https://github.com/sasanrose/phpredmin). We are going to migrate to Symfony shortly.
>
> *Note:* PHP Redis Admin is mostly compatible with [phpredis](https://github.com/phpredis/phpredis) redis module for PHP

Installation
------------

[](#installation)

### Docker

[](#docker)

You can use **[docker](https://www.docker.com)** to run PHP Redis Admin:

```
docker run -p 8080:80 -d --name php-redis-admin faktiva/php-redis-admin
```

And then you can just easily point your broswer to

**Note:***You can use **ENV variables** to override any configuration directive of PHP Redis Admin.*

Moreover, you can just use **docker compose** to also setup a redis container using the provided `docker-compose.yml` as a startpoint:

```
docker-compose up -d
```

### Manual installation

[](#manual-installation)

Just drop PHP Redis Admin in your webserver's root directory and point your browser to it (You also need [phpredis](https://github.com/phpredis/phpredis) installed)

Configuration
-------------

[](#configuration)

**You can copy `app/config/config.dist.php`to `app/config/config.php` and edit as you need. Of course you can also include the original file at the beginning, overriding only the configuration you need and retaining the distribution defaults.**

```
// app/config/config.php

require_once __DIR__.'/config.dist.php';

$config = array_merge(
    $config,
    array(
		/*
		 * the following are your custom settings ...
		 */
        'debug' => true,
        'auth' => null,
        'log' => array(
            'driver'    => 'file',
            'threshold' => 5, /* 0: Disable Logging, 1: Error, 2: Warning, 3: Notice, 4: Info, 5: Debug */
            'file'      => array('directory' => 'var/logs')
        ),
    )
);

return $config;
```

**Note:***If your redis server is on an IP or port other than defaults (`localhost:6379`), you should specify it in your config file.*

Apache configuration example (`/etc/httpd/conf.d/phpredmin.conf`):

```
# PHP Redis Admin sample apache configuration
#
# Allows only localhost by default

Alias /phpredmin /var/www/phpredmin/web

   AllowOverride All

     # Apache 2.4

       Require ip localhost
       Require local

     # Apache 2.2
     Order Deny,Allow
     Deny from All
     Allow from 127.0.0.1
     Allow from ::1

```

### Basic Authentication

[](#basic-authentication)

By default, the dashboard is password protected using **Basic Authentication** mechanism, with the default username and password set to `admin`.

You can find the `auth` config section inside the `config.dist.php` file.

**Note:**You **should** use the `[password_hash()](http://php.net/manual/en/function.password-hash.php)` PHP function with your desired password and store the result in the `password` config key, instead of storing the plaintext password as shown int the distributed config file.

Features
--------

[](#features)

See [Features.md](Features.md)

###  Health Score

35

—

LowBetter than 80% of packages

Maintenance20

Infrequent updates — may be unmaintained

Popularity28

Limited adoption so far

Community25

Small or concentrated contributor base

Maturity61

Established project with proven stability

 Bus Factor1

Top contributor holds 61.9% of commits — single point of failure

How is this calculated?**Maintenance (25%)** — Last commit recency, latest release date, and issue-to-star ratio. Uses a 2-year decay window.

**Popularity (30%)** — Total and monthly downloads, GitHub stars, and forks. Logarithmic scaling prevents top-heavy scores.

**Community (15%)** — Contributors, dependents, forks, watchers, and maintainers. Measures real ecosystem engagement.

**Maturity (30%)** — Project age, version count, PHP version support, and release stability.

###  Release Activity

Cadence

Every ~11 days

Total

4

Last Release

3455d ago

### Community

Maintainers

![](https://www.gravatar.com/avatar/810d27e68c0416378d31063ae4567375d525beb06c762b0a1a23863ce6f3d878?d=identicon)[faktiva](/maintainers/faktiva)

---

Top Contributors

[![sasanrose](https://avatars.githubusercontent.com/u/374499?v=4)](https://github.com/sasanrose "sasanrose (203 commits)")[![drAlberT](https://avatars.githubusercontent.com/u/1442700?v=4)](https://github.com/drAlberT "drAlberT (64 commits)")[![blitzmann](https://avatars.githubusercontent.com/u/3904767?v=4)](https://github.com/blitzmann "blitzmann (24 commits)")[![eugef](https://avatars.githubusercontent.com/u/895071?v=4)](https://github.com/eugef "eugef (13 commits)")[![lovette](https://avatars.githubusercontent.com/u/430169?v=4)](https://github.com/lovette "lovette (5 commits)")[![luongvm](https://avatars.githubusercontent.com/u/4680820?v=4)](https://github.com/luongvm "luongvm (4 commits)")[![toubsen](https://avatars.githubusercontent.com/u/553786?v=4)](https://github.com/toubsen "toubsen (2 commits)")[![lzref](https://avatars.githubusercontent.com/u/2106453?v=4)](https://github.com/lzref "lzref (2 commits)")[![nervo](https://avatars.githubusercontent.com/u/95935?v=4)](https://github.com/nervo "nervo (2 commits)")[![nilportugues](https://avatars.githubusercontent.com/u/550948?v=4)](https://github.com/nilportugues "nilportugues (2 commits)")[![marios-zindilis](https://avatars.githubusercontent.com/u/412713?v=4)](https://github.com/marios-zindilis "marios-zindilis (1 commits)")[![tortuetorche](https://avatars.githubusercontent.com/u/5038872?v=4)](https://github.com/tortuetorche "tortuetorche (1 commits)")[![ahmed-hamdy90](https://avatars.githubusercontent.com/u/2749816?v=4)](https://github.com/ahmed-hamdy90 "ahmed-hamdy90 (1 commits)")[![BlackIkeEagle](https://avatars.githubusercontent.com/u/293691?v=4)](https://github.com/BlackIkeEagle "BlackIkeEagle (1 commits)")[![HemeraGP](https://avatars.githubusercontent.com/u/4418630?v=4)](https://github.com/HemeraGP "HemeraGP (1 commits)")[![gsouf](https://avatars.githubusercontent.com/u/3215399?v=4)](https://github.com/gsouf "gsouf (1 commits)")[![stuntguy3000](https://avatars.githubusercontent.com/u/1522389?v=4)](https://github.com/stuntguy3000 "stuntguy3000 (1 commits)")

---

Tags

adminadmin-paneladministration-panelphpredisredis-admin

###  Code Quality

Code StylePHP CS Fixer

### Embed Badge

![Health badge](/badges/faktiva-php-redis-admin/health.svg)

```
[![Health](https://phpackages.com/badges/faktiva-php-redis-admin/health.svg)](https://phpackages.com/packages/faktiva-php-redis-admin)
```

###  Alternatives

[predis/predis

A flexible and feature-complete Redis/Valkey client for PHP.

7.8k305.7M2.4k](/packages/predis-predis)[snc/redis-bundle

A Redis bundle for Symfony

1.0k39.4M67](/packages/snc-redis-bundle)[react/cache

Async, Promise-based cache interface for ReactPHP

444112.4M40](/packages/react-cache)[wp-media/wp-rocket

Performance optimization plugin for WordPress

7431.3M3](/packages/wp-media-wp-rocket)[illuminate/cache

The Illuminate Cache package.

12835.6M1.4k](/packages/illuminate-cache)[colinmollenhour/php-redis-session-abstract

A Redis-based session handler with optimistic locking

6325.6M14](/packages/colinmollenhour-php-redis-session-abstract)

PHPackages © 2026

[Directory](/)[Categories](/categories)[Trending](/trending)[Changelog](/changelog)[Analyze](/analyze)
